The SourcrLab bottom line

A long-established US talent management vendor now presenting as ClearCo, with the offering split into ClearRecruit, ClearTalent, ClearGrow, ClearLearn and a bundled TotalTalent. The recruiting module is a real ATS with onboarding attached, and the suite argument is genuine: performance and engagement data staying with the same employee record has value that a standalone ATS cannot match. Everything commercial is behind a quote, with no trial and no self-serve route, so cost and value cannot be judged from outside. The recent rebrand also means older reviews and comparisons refer to a product structure that no longer matches the site.

Best fit

A US employer that wants recruiting, onboarding, performance and engagement from one vendor with one contract, and is willing to run a procurement process to get there.

Think twice if

If you only need an ATS. You would be buying a module of a suite, priced by quote, with no way to try it and no published figure to compare against a standalone product.

Why choose ClearCompany?

One employee record from application to performance review

The suite argument is real: what a hiring manager wrote at interview stays connected to what the same person is later assessed on, without an integration to maintain.

Modules can be bought separately

ClearRecruit, ClearTalent, ClearGrow and ClearLearn are sold on their own or bundled as TotalTalent, so you are not forced into the whole suite on day one.

A long-established vendor in the US mid-market

It has been sold for over a decade with a substantial customer base, which lowers the risk of the product being discontinued underneath you.

Main trade-offs

No price, and five modules to negotiate

Nothing is published: no figure, no unit, no minimum. With a modular suite, two buyers can pay very different amounts for what they both call the same product.

The rebrand has broken the paper trail

The site now says ClearCo while most reviews, analyst notes and comparisons still say ClearCompany and describe the older packaging. Check that anything you read still matches what is being sold.

You cannot try the ATS on its own merits

No trial and no self-serve signup, and the demo will show the suite. If applicant tracking is your only requirement, this is a hard product to evaluate honestly against a standalone one.

Pricing and buying reality

Quoted only, by module. No prices are published

  • Sold as modular packages: ClearRecruit, ClearTalent, ClearGrow and ClearLearn, with TotalTalent as the combined offering
  • No published price for any module, no pricing unit and no stated minimum
  • No free plan, no free trial and no self-serve signup: the route to purchase is a booked demo
  • The vendor now presents as ClearCo; older material and reviews use the ClearCompany name and the previous packaging
  • Primarily sold in the United States

What we do not know

  • Any price at all, per module or bundled
  • Whether pricing is per employee, per user or per hire
  • Whether the ATS can be bought genuinely on its own
  • Implementation timeline and cost for a modular deployment
